Overview
Twins Jewelry Internal Systems is a collection of software tools designed around the operational needs of a working jewelry business. It replaces disconnected manual processes with a structured system for managing customers, services, transactions, communication, and business activity.
Rather than being a portfolio demo, the system is actively used as part of daily operations and continues to evolve as new workflows and business requirements emerge.
The problem
Daily operations relied heavily on paper records and disconnected manual processes, with no structured digital system tying the business together.
Customer information, repairs, layaways, battery warranties, custom work, transactions, and service history were often managed through separate paper trails or independent processes. Without a shared digital structure, information could become difficult to search, verify, update, or connect back to the same customer.
This created data integrity challenges such as inconsistent customer information, duplicate records, incomplete history, and a greater dependence on employees remembering where information had been recorded. Reporting and reviewing past activity also required manually piecing information together.
Customer communication was also limited. There was no centralized system for sending or tracking service notifications, intake confirmations, ready-for-pickup updates, or other status messages tied directly to a customer's activity.
Because most operational information was not digitized, there was also no practical way to perform meaningful data analysis across the business. Written records made it difficult to identify trends, compare activity over time, review customer history at scale, or turn day-to-day operational data into useful reporting.
The goal was to replace that fragmented paper-based workflow with a structured internal system where customer records, operational activity, communication, and business data could be connected, searched, updated, tracked, and eventually analyzed consistently.
Customer profiles
A shared customer record connects activity across the business.
Customer profiles provide a central place for contact information, service history, communication preferences, consent status, promotional activity, discount records, and other customer-related information.
Repairs, layaways, battery warranties, custom work, and communications can be associated with the same customer instead of remaining isolated records.

Communication
Customer notifications are part of the workflow rather than a separate process.
The system integrates transactional email and text messaging for customer service updates such as intake confirmations and service status notifications.
Communication preferences and consent are stored alongside customer information so employees can manage customer communication within the same operational environment.
